Why a $100 Account Beats Demo Trading for Emotional Discipline

Demo accounts are great for learning software, but they fail to trigger human emotions.

When real money is on the line—even just a $100 balance—your brain reacts differently.

  • You feel the sting of a loss.
  • You feel the urge to close winning trades too early.
  • You learn how to manage fear and greed.

A small $100 account forces you to respect the market in a way fake money never will.

Understanding 0.01 Lot Sizes: How to Risk Only $2 Per Trade

Micro-lot execution is your best friend. When you trade 0.01 lots with a $100 balance, you control your downside.

By risking only $2 per trade (the 2% rule), you give yourself 50 chances to be wrong before blowing your account. This precise risk management provides the breathing room necessary to learn.

The Role of Leverage: Why 1:100 is the Standard for Small Account Success

Because you are trading small amounts, you need to understand margin requirements. Leverage of 1:100 allows you to control a position size large enough to make technical swing trading viable, while your micro-lot sizing ensures your actual dollar risk remains tiny.

Focusing on Majors: Why EUR/USD and GBP/USD Offer the Lowest Spreads

When trading with limited funds, fees matter. Stick to major currency pairs like EUR/USD and GBP/USD. They offer the highest liquidity and the tightest spreads, meaning less of your $100 goes to the broker.

The 2% Rule vs. The “All-In” Temptation

It is tempting to risk $50 on a single trade because “it’s only $50.” Do not do this. If you are risking more than $2 per trade on a $100 account, you are gambling, not learning. Stick to the 2% rule.

Dealing with Swap Fees: Why Holding for Weeks Can Eat Your $100

Swing trading involves holding positions overnight. Brokers charge “swap fees” for this privilege. If you hold a micro-lot position for several weeks, these daily micro-fees will silently drain your $100 margin. Always factor overnight costs into your risk parameters.
